ARM: EXYNOS4: Use samsung_rev() to distinguish silicon revision
authorKukjin Kim <kgene.kim@samsung.com>
Sat, 20 Aug 2011 04:41:21 +0000 (13:41 +0900)
committerKukjin Kim <kgene.kim@samsung.com>
Wed, 24 Aug 2011 11:26:03 +0000 (20:26 +0900)
This patch uses samsung_rev() to support variable silicon revision of
EXYNOS4210 so that can support for EXYNOS4210 REV0, REV1.0 and REV1.1.

Note: Need to change timer setting on REV0.
